Video Camera Mount uses suction cups that adhere to the tank. It's made of CNC billet aluminum and has stainless steel fasteners. Fully adjustable and works on any motorcycle.The video camera mount has four adjustable arms, designed to get the best possible camera angle. Sold world wide and tested by the best magazines. This video camera mount is sure to give you something to talk about when your riding buddies see your "on board footage".

I bought it but I noticed it unsticks after a while, the suction cups unstick by themselves.I dont want to loose a good camcorder. :BangHead:


how do you have it secured? Mine doesnt unstick, your cups might be dryed out, go get some new ones, they are cheap, also, they need to mate to a FLAT surface, and curves in the tank will mess up the suction action.
